Outline
Modules - overview, intended learning outcomes and course content.
M02: History, Definitions and Roles: Early day blood-letting and history of phlebotomy. Definitions and roles within healthcare environments.
M03: Work-flow Cycles: Phlebotomist and laboratory work flow cycles.
M04: Professionalism: Interacting with patients and staff including patient confidentiality and GDPR.
M05: Health and Safety: Keeping Safe. Bloodborne pathogens and work practice controls. Effective use of PPE. Standard Precautions. Waste disposal. Needle-stick injuries and how to avoid.
M06: Blood Collection Systems: A detailed look at three blood collection systems and associated equipment.
Practical Session 1: Equipment familiarisation. Hands-on approach.
M07: Anatomy and Physiology: An overview of the integumentary system and cardiovascular system. Understanding veins, arteries, capillaries and nerves, and their locations.
Practical Session 2: Using the tourniquet and identifying a vein. Hands-on approach.
M08: Blood Composition: A detailed look at the composition of blood. Routine tests on whole blood and routine tests on serum and plasma, including profiles.
M09: Using the Equipment: A detailed look at one blood collection system (Vacutainer), including standard and butterfly needles and all associated equipment. A comparison of Vacutainer with Monovette and respective merits. Sterilisation processes. Bottle types and handling. Coagulants and anticolagulants. Blood Culture collection.
Practical Session 3: Handling and assembling the equipment. Hands-on approach using vein blocks. Familiarisation and procedures including initial skill-set development.
M10: Performing the Venepuncture: Pre-venepuncture procedures. The venepuncture. Post-venepuncture procedures. Order of Draw. Complications - causes and solutions. Consent types.
Patient ID. Special Requests. Implementing Standard Precautions.
Practical Session 4: Handling and assembling the equipment. Hands-on approach using vein blocks. Skill-set development and consolidation.
M11: Lab Tests & Bottle Types: A detailed look at test requests and associated departments.
Haematology, Biochemistry and Microbiology requests. Special Biochemistry tests. Sample handling and timing.
Practical Session 5: Performing the venepuncture (on artificial arms). Palpating the vein, performing the venepuncture and consolidating pre- and post-venepuncture procedures. Further skill-set development.
